Frtala’s pragmatism faces Holoubek’s pressing at Juliska
AC Dukla Praha are still in the early stages of rebuilding under David Holoubek, who was appointed as head coach on July 1st 2025. The high-energy side that he is creating has a pressing, proactive tactical identity that will aim to force the opponent into errors and make use of turnovers in transition.
Our AC Dukla Praha vs FK Teplice prediction is influenced by Holoubek’s record: His men have only won one, drawn two and lost two of their last five matches in all competitions. Dukla Praha are on a two-match losing streak, having been beaten 2-0 at SK Slavia Prague after a 0-2 home loss to Bohemians 1905. They have a home record of one win, two draws and one loss, conceding four goals in four matches at Juliska, so the Juliska is certainly not a fortress.
The AC Dukla Praha vs FK Teplice preview highlights Teplice's similarly poor start to the 2025/2026 season, languishing in 15th position after failing to notch a single victory from their opening ten games. Zdenko Frtala has been in charge at the club since March 2023 and has made the side a pragmatic, disciplined team that can be a tough nut to crack.
